Bois Saint-Hilaire
Bois Saint-Hilaire is a forest in Rœux, Arrondissement of Arras, Hauts-de-France. Bois Saint-Hilaire is situated nearby to the village Rœux, as well as near Pelves.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Monchy-le-Preux is a commune in the Pas-de-Calais department in the Hauts-de-France region of France ten kilometres southeast of Arras.
